gcc/libgfortran
Hans-Peter Nilsson 25abf44844 re PR libfortran/35293 (truncation errors with gfortran.dg/streamio_11.f90, 3, 4 and 15.)
PR libfortran/35293
	* io/unix.c (fd_truncate): Fold s->special_file case into
	success case of ftruncate/chsize call instead of the failure case.
	Make failure case actually return failure.  Properly update stream
	pointers on failure.  Call runtime_error for targets without
	neither ftruncate nor chsize where such a call would be needed.

From-SVN: r132888
2008-03-05 01:50:33 +00:00
..
config
generated ifunction_logical.m4: Add casts to get rid of warnings. 2008-02-25 12:02:56 +00:00
intrinsics re PR fortran/33197 (Fortran 2008: math functions) 2008-03-03 23:46:20 +00:00
io re PR libfortran/35293 (truncation errors with gfortran.dg/streamio_11.f90, 3, 4 and 15.) 2008-03-05 01:50:33 +00:00
m4 ifunction_logical.m4: Add casts to get rid of warnings. 2008-02-25 12:02:56 +00:00
runtime
acinclude.m4 re PR libfortran/32841 (HUGE(1.0_16) output as +Infinity on ppc-darwin8 (gfortran.dg/large_real_kind_2.F90)) 2008-02-24 11:59:09 +00:00
aclocal.m4
c99_protos.h
ChangeLog re PR libfortran/35293 (truncation errors with gfortran.dg/streamio_11.f90, 3, 4 and 15.) 2008-03-05 01:50:33 +00:00
ChangeLog-2002
ChangeLog-2003
ChangeLog-2004
ChangeLog-2005
ChangeLog-2006
ChangeLog-2007
config.h.in re PR fortran/33197 (Fortran 2008: math functions) 2008-03-03 23:46:20 +00:00
configure re PR fortran/33197 (Fortran 2008: math functions) 2008-03-03 23:46:20 +00:00
configure.ac
configure.host
fmain.c
gfortran.map re PR fortran/33197 (Fortran 2008: math functions) 2008-03-03 23:46:20 +00:00
libgfortran.h
libtool-version
Makefile.am re PR fortran/33197 (Fortran 2008: math functions) 2008-03-03 23:46:20 +00:00
Makefile.in re PR fortran/33197 (Fortran 2008: math functions) 2008-03-03 23:46:20 +00:00
mk-kinds-h.sh
mk-sik-inc.sh
mk-srk-inc.sh